INDORE: Shivraj Singh Chouhan, the chief minister of Madhya Pradesh, said on Thursday that investors are enthusiastic and eager to invest in Madhya Pradesh. The Chief Minister made the statement while addressing media persons in Indore.

“The enthusiasm among the investors is so much that we are not even able to sleep.  Investors want to come here and invest, I have to meet them one-to-one again. Really, Madhya Pradesh’s sun of good fortune has risen.” Madhya Pradesh will now become a USD 550 billion economy and investors will play an important role in it, he added.
